**Q: What are the opening hours over the holidays?**

Good question — Pemberton House runs on skeleton hours between the two bank holidays, roughly 09:00 to 16:00. The main doors stay locked the whole time, so everyone comes in through the courtyard entrance. Heating is reduced, so bring a jumper! To get through the courtyard door, punch in the code below.

door code, yagap-bahof: bdg-O-05

## Releases

Migraloom handles schema migrations with zero downtime by expanding first and contracting later: every release adds columns and backfills before any code reads them, and drops nothing until two versions on. New team members should never squash migration files after tagging. Each release artifact must be verified before the orchestrator will run it against production at Hallowmere Data. Verification uses our team signing key, which is:

deploy key for kajof-fajop: bky6_gDHw9Q

### Pagination

The Quillbrook public REST API paginates all list endpoints using opaque cursors. Each response includes a `next_cursor` field; pass it unchanged as the `cursor` query parameter to fetch the subsequent page. Page size defaults to 25 and caps at 100 via the `limit` parameter. Never construct cursors manually, as their encoding may change between releases. When testing pagination against the internal mirror environment, requests must authenticate with the service key provided below.

gateway credential: qvz11-0UzFBR2ZJRm

MEMO — Kettling Depot Receiving

Uniform sets for the new Kettling depot arrive Wednesday via Ashgrove courier: 40 boxes, sorted by size, manifest attached to box one. Check the count at the dock before signing; shortages go straight to stores, not the courier. The hand-over instruction the courier will follow is set out below.

drop instructions, tafof-baguf: the holmir gilox courier leaves the sormir ulaok holdor ledger at gate 5596 under passcode 257343